‘77 440 stock block and heads, ch4b, avs2 carb, 727 with stock 68 converter, 3.23 rear.
I have a xe262 cam that I’m getting ready to put in but wondering if I should run it advanced. I’ve read through some threads where it’s been mentioned to advance it up to 6* for the low compression. Is it worth doing and how does it affect a tune? I was also looking at some converters but the rpm range is 1300-5600 On the cam, does that range change when advancing the cam? This thing is super low compression, 120 psi on all cylinders tested cold. I know pistons and heads is the true fix but I’m poor right now and I want to drive my car with what I have.

that cam has 4 degrees of advance ground into to it to begin with. don't advance it anymore. it's a fairly small cam even for a low compression 440.
